PART 750 Requirements for Surface Coal Mining Operations on Indian <br />Lands <br />750.12 Permit Applications for Indian Lands <br />GCC Energy, LLC will submit all application fees and permit <br />application package copies (PAP) in accordance with OSMRE <br />schedules and requirements. <br />750.12(d)(1) Mining Plan and Resource Recovery and Protection Plan <br />The mining plan as required by 43 CFR 3480, Subpart 3482 <br />(Resource Recovery and Protection Plans) is included in this PAP as <br />Appendix 6 (1). Subpart 3487 (Logical Mining Unit) is not applicable <br />to this area. <br />750.12(d)(2)(i) Socioeconomic Impacts From the Mining Plan <br />The King I Mine began operation in 1941 and achieved its average <br />production level by 1988. The mine was been an integral part of the <br />economy and society of La Plata and Montezuma counties, Colorado <br />for more than 67 years. No change is anticipated in any information <br />required by 750.12(d)(2). The BLM Lease and permit area is an <br />extension of mine workings to be developed beginning in the State of <br />Colorado lease. The King I Mine workings were depleted and the mine <br />was closed in January of 2009, and the workforce was moved to the <br />King II Mine with no changes in the levels of personnel, production or <br />economic and environmental impacts. <br />The King II Mine Workforce <br />As of August, 2014, GCC Energy, LLC employed approximately 139 <br />persons. Employment is expected to vary no more than twenty <br />percent from this level throughout the life of the mine. At this time it <br />is not possible to accurately estimate when fluctuations in the size of <br />the workforce might occur. <br />The GCC Energy workforce is broken down into the following classes: <br />Administrative/ Office 7 <br />Underground employees 115 <br />Surface employees 17 <br />Employees of GCC Energy live primarily in La Plata, Montezuma and <br />San Juan Counties of Colorado and San Juan County of New Mexico. <br />GCC Energy, LLC <br />Part 750 <br />Page 1 <br />King II Mine Extension PAP CO -0106 <br />(BLM Lease COC- 62920) <br />October 24, 2014 (RN -01) <br />
